The Renault Key Card Dilemma
If you drive a Renault manufactured in the last twenty years, chances are you do not use a standard metal key; you use a Key Card. While streamlined and hassle-free to slide into a pocket or wallet, these cards are prone to particular problems:
- Internal Micro-Switch Failure: Over time, the buttons inside the card can remove from the internal circuit board. You may hear a rattling noise inside the card when you shake it.
- Battery Degradation: If your car stops working to recognize the card passively, the CR2032 coin battery likely needs replacement.
- Coil Damage: Dropping the card repeatedly can split the internal transponder coil, rendering the car not able to begin even if the main locking still functions.
Common Signs Your Renault Key Card is Failing:
- The car intermittently stops working to identify the card ("Card Not Detected" message on the dash).
- Central locking just works when you push the buttons right beside the motorist's window.
- The automobile starts just when the card is inserted fully into the control panel slot.
What Information Do You Need to Provide?
When you finally find a trusted vehicle locksmith or dealer near you, they will require particular information to cut and configure your brand-new Renault Car Key Replacement Near Me key properly. Be prepared to offer:
- Vehicle Identification Number (VIN): A 17-digit code found on the chauffeur's side dashboard (noticeable through the windshield) or on your car registration documents.
- Evidence of Ownership: Vehicle title, registration, or a valid insurance coverage card matching your government-issued picture ID. Locksmiths must confirm ownership to prevent vehicle theft.
- Exact Model and Year: Renault configurations can alter mid-year, so precise details matter.
- Key Tipo/ Part Number: If you have a broken key card, note whether it is a 3-button, 4-button, or hands-free variation.
